                1. A group of people within hearing; specifically, a large gathering of people listening to or watching a performance, speech, etc.
We joined the audience just as the lights went down.
2. Hearing; the condition or state of hearing or listening.
3. A widespread or nationwide viewing or listening public, as of a TV or radio network or program.
4. A formal meeting with a state or religious dignitary.
She managed to get an audience with the Pope.
5. The readership of a book or other written publication.
"Private Eye" has a small but faithful audience.
6. A following.
The opera singer expanded his audience by singing songs from the shows.
7. An audiencia (judicial court of the Spanish empire), or the territory administered by it.
